Post Posted: Mon Nov 22, 2010 8:32 am 
 

misterspock wrote:Two of the Privateer Press Witchfire books in this lot (one and two)


** expired/removed eBay auction **




The first two of the trilogy have NEVER gone for much as they are as common as dirt.

The third booklet is the one that is less common and normally sells for more than the first two combined.



I have seen the first two booklets sell for less than $2 each (USD) and for as much as $10 each.

While I have seen the third booklet sell for over $30 (USD) and for as low as $5.
